>       how can i proceed if i have a so called business logic,
>       transactions, update conflicts?

Zope handles transactions for you, the rest should be handled by your RDBMS

>       i downloaded zope3, is there a big changes from version 2.x?

In some ways, yes. Zope 3 is not finished yet and I think that few people 
on this list are using it so if you need help you are better off starting 
with Zope 2.x particularly as the documentation is better.
